Calculation of average rate with complex stoichiometry

high

NEET frequently tests the ability to apply stoichiometric coefficients correctly. A question might involve a reaction with different coefficients for reactants and products, requiring students to calculate the average rate of one species given the rate of another over a specific time interval. This tests both calculation and conceptual understanding of rate definition.

Graphical determination of instantaneous rate and comparison with average rate

medium

A common question type involves providing a concentration-time graph and asking for the instantaneous rate at a particular time (requiring tangent slope calculation) or comparing the average rate over an interval with an instantaneous rate. This tests graphical interpretation skills and the core distinction between the two rate types.

Conceptual questions on factors affecting instantaneous rate

medium

While direct calculation is common, NEET also includes conceptual questions. A question might ask how temperature, concentration, or catalyst presence would affect the instantaneous rate, or why the instantaneous rate typically decreases over time, requiring a deeper understanding of the underlying kinetic principles.
